Redwood extended their winning streak to four on Friday, bumping them up to 5-2. They were the clear victors by a 35-13 margin over the Monache Marauders. The Rangers' offense checked out after the first half but had enough points banked to take the game anyway.

Jimmie Burk contin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 165 yards and three scores while picking up 7.5 yards per carry. Another big playmaker for Redwood was Jairus Brooks, who returned a punt for a touchdown.

Wins are hard to come by when you can't run the rock, something Redwood proved: they limited Monache to a paltry 2.5 yards per carry. The team can thank Enrique Segura for the heroic effort on defense: he. Redwood is a perfect 4-0 when they shut down the run game so well.

Special teams also deserves some recognition, posting 11 points in total. The biggest highlight from special teams (and perhaps the team as a whole) came courtesy of Brooks, who ran a punt back for a touchdown.

As for Monache, with the defeat, they broke their four-game winning streak and moved their record to 5-2. They were red-hot offensively heading into the game (they scored no less than 31 points in the five matchups prior), but Redwood's defense proved too tough.

Monache lost despite a true team effort on offense. The best among them was Devin Rodriguez, who threw for 235 yards and a pair of TDs on only 15 passes. Monache's leading receiver Jasiah Rodriguez was Devin's top target yet again, picking up 88 receiving yards and one touchdown.

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ming contests. Redwood will venture away from home to challenge Golden West at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. The Rangers will need to watch out since the Trailblazers have now posted at least 31 points in their last three games. As for Monache, they will head out to take on Mt. Whitney at 7:30 p.m. on Friday.
